How they compare

Lebanon currently reports 147 1000 USD against 138 1000 USD in Bermuda, a difference of 9 1000 USD.

That makes Lebanon's figure about 1.1 times Bermuda's.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 10 shared years of data; in 2015 it was Lebanon ahead.

Bermuda ranks 102nd and Lebanon ranks 99th of 216 countries.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
